#2380 Pki-server instance commands throws exception while specifying invalid parameters.
Closed: Fixed Opened by akahat@redhat.com.

pki-server instance-* subcommands throws exception
while providing wrong parameters.

Steps to Reproduce:

pki-server instance-nuxwdog-enable RoootCAA

Actual results:

printing traceback.

Expected results:

It shows Invalid instance error.
